Eligibility Criteria

Inclusion

  • A subject must meet the following criteria to be eligible for inclusion in the study:
  • Patient must be of Hispanic ethnicity residing in Puerto Rico. Age 21 to 75 years old at time of informed consent. Evidence of MASLD by vibration-controlled transient elastography (FibroScan) controlled attenuation parameter (CAP) (value must be greater than or equal to 248 dB/m).
  • Willing and able to provide informed consent signed by study subject. Willing and able to understand and complete study-related procedures.

Exclusion

  • A subject who meets any of the following criteria will be excluded from the study:
  • Excessive alcohol intake for ≥3 months during past year prior to screening (\>3 units/day for males and \>2 units/day for female is generally considered excessive).
  • History of liver transplant, or current placement on a liver transplant list. History of viral and resolved hepatitis (Hepatitis B or C) or human immunodeficiency virus (HIV).
  • Use of antibiotics within 14 days of screening.
